A Real-Time Energy Meter for Medical Excimer Laser

    A laser power/energy meter which is designed based on laser induced thermoelectric voltage (LITV) effect was reported. The laser power/energy meter can not only measure and record the energy of every input laser pulse and the total real-time energy, but also can record the response waveform of every input laser pulse. It realize the real-time controlling for laser energy. It was used to simulating experiment for 248 nm excimer laser. The result show that the relative standard deviation (RSD) of the laser output energy is 8.6%~10.7% with repetition frequency. And under the simulating setup parameters of refractive surgery, 193 nm excimer laser was measured, and its RSD is 8.3%. This kind of laser power/energy meter would be very significant in cornea refraction operation.
